Sports and Recreation

In 1906, a hockey team from Smiths Falls launched an unsuccessful challenge to win the Stanley Cup. Smiths Falls was home to a professional baseball team, the Smiths Falls Beavers, for one season in 1937. The team was a part of the Canadian-American League.

The town is currently home to the Junior A hockey team Smiths Falls Bears, who play in the Central Canada Hockey League.
